6495-07-4,393548-93-1,328055-94-3,328055-95-4,33734-70-2,102536-31-2 Supplier | CHEMOLED.COM
CMO CDMO service. CHEMOLED.COM supply 6495-07-4,393548-93-1,328055-94-3,328055-95-4,33734-70-2,102536-31-2 and related compounds.
102536-31-2 328055-95-4 6495-07-4 393548-93-1 33734-70-2 328055-94-3